Space Expatriate

Players act as companies and operate with four decks of cards representing portable space station modules of different types: some deliver resources from Earth and use them for experiments and studies, others increase the company’s influence in the international arena.
The game is ideal for more experiences players, although families will have a lot of fun too, if children are above the age of 12 and good at English.

Description

During each round, players select actions from a set of available (open draft). The action card is immediately docked to the player’s Station, meaning that the players always consider two aspects: whether they need a card itself, and whether they need an action. When the active player selects an action, it gets executed by all players simultaneously, while the active player obtains some additional benefit.

The action itself consists of simple operations over cards, resources, and Terraforming Points. Players tend to build strong production-consumption chains made of Delivery, Engineering, and Terraforming station modules. There is also a shared resource pool, which is made of unused resources and affects all the players. It provides a way of indirect economical pressure on other players.

Military cards open tactical possibilities like a better choice of cards in hand or move priority. There is also a way of direct interaction on Military action. The victim of that action gets a compensation which depends on the player’s military supremacy. So the smart management of military power gives to a player strong starting points for other actions execution.
